AT a meeting of the Académie de Medecine de Paris on May 18th M. Pierre Marie and M. Gustave Roussy presented an important paper on the prevention of bedsores after wounds of the spinal cord in the war. The conditions of trench warfare have rendered wounds of the spine frequent among the French soldiers, for during their assaults the Germans naturally try to attack in the flank, while shells often burst behind the lines. As the cervical and upper dorsal regions are protected by the knapsack, wounds are less frequent there than in the dorso-lumbar and sacral regions. M. Marie and M. Roussy have found that the prognosis of the paraplegia produced, though grave, is much better than the prognosis of paraplegia observed in civil life. The military surgeon should therefore not adopt the pessimistic view that if the cord is injured the patient is lost. On the contrary, remarkable improvement is possible if means are taken to avoid the serious complications-bedsores and sphincter troubles. It is generally believed that bedsores are trophic lesions, the direct result of the spinal lesion, and therefore unavoidable. This was taught by the old masters, Charcot, Vulpian, and Brown-Sequard, who knew nothing of antisepsis. M. Marie and M Roussy traverse it in their paper. They did not deny the trophic influence of the nerve centres, but they insisted that the failure of this is not sufficient to produce bedsores. One of two factors is necessary and often both combined. These are prolonged compression and infection. In a case of traumatic transverse lesion of the spinal cord with complete motor and sensory paraplegia the patient cannot change his position, and the weight of half of the trunk and of the lower limbs rests on the sacrum and heels. The prolonged com- pression and impaired circulation produce slough- ing in parts, the nutrition of which is lowered by the spinal lesion. Added to this is the loss of sensibility, which in normal persons causes a change of posture when the least sensible discom- fort from pressure is produced. The points of pressure first become red, then an ecchymotic parch- ment-like patch appears and soon takes the appear- ance of several flattened bullse containing bloody fluid. The dry eschar thus produced is relatively benign, but is almost fatal if another factor- moisture-intervenes. This may be furnished by moist dressings or by prolonged contact with urine or faeces. Decomposing urine becomes the vehicle of innumerable microbes, aerobic and anaerobic, which penetrate into the tissues when the epi- dermis has been lost, and cause extensive slough- ing. This view of the pathogenesis of bedsores is proved by the fact that they have no relation to the position of the spinal lesion. Whether this is upper dorsal, lower dorsal, or lumbo-sacral they always begin on the sacrum and then on the heels or other parts of the lower limbs. More- over, they have no relation to the extent of the spinal lesion. Bedsores appear with the sphincter troubles and if these cease they dis- appear. A man with a wound of the spinal cord who has no incontinence ought not to have a bed sore. One who has incontinence of urine will have this complication if the most rigorous measures are not adopted. In case of retention of urine M. Marie and M. Roussy recommended, to secure that the patient need not receive special attention during the hours or days of transport to the base, that a catheter should be fixed with an obturator in the bladder. The bladder can thus be emptied from time to time by an Mt/M’tey or by the patient himself. The same method can be used in the rarer cases of primary incontinence. Rectal troubles are more difficult to deal with. If there are soft liquid stools opium should be given at the moment of evacua- tion to induce constipation. In all cases the skin should be protected with talc or coated with grease or vaseline. The patient should be placed on an air cushion or a leather cushion with a central hollow which will prevent contact of the skin with the dejecta during transport. After arrival at the base hospital the majority of the patients have bedsores. Their position should be changed at least hourly during the day and every two hours during the night. In this way, said the authors, even if deep sores have formed during transport they will yield to this attention with antiseptics and dry dressings. LATENT FRACTURE AND FRACTURE-DISLOCATION OF CERVICAL VERTEBRÆ. IN the Medical Journal of Australia Mr. Alan Newton has published a valuable paper on a subject which has not received much attention-latent fracture and fracture-dislocation of cervical vertebrae. Before the introduction of the X rays the term " latent " was applied to cervical fractures unaccompanied by injury of the cord. From time to time cases were reported of death from displace- ment of the fragments of an unsuspected fracture. Such injuries are probably not uncommon, and are not recognised because in the majority of cases they do not give rise to subsequent inconvenience. In 1855 Mr. Simons reported the case of a girl, aged 18 years, who fell down an embankment 12 feet high. She remained quite well until 15 days later, when she was admitted into St. Thomas’s Hospital, where she died three days later. At the necropsy horizontal fracture of the body of the seventh cervical vertebra and a large abscess between the dura and the vertebrae were found. Sir Astley Cooper mentions the case of a girl who, after a severe blow on the neck, was compelled when she wished to look upwards or downwards to support her head with her hands and carefully to elevate or depress it. She died of an intercurrent disease 12 months later, and a fracture of the atlas was found. Fracture of the atlas without injury of the cord is comparatively uncommon.
